This is a three-day breathwork and indigenous medicine retreat designed to optimize your experience and allow for lasting transformation. At Menla, we will be surrounded by the nature of the Catskill Mountains which will support a sense of nurturing and wellbeing as we explore non-ordinary states of consciousness and integration.

Breathwork is a way of adjusting and modulating your breath that creates an altered state of mind. Clients have reported having visualizations, insight, relaxation, self-awareness and transcendent experiences akin to what one would expect with a psychedelic medicine. Individuals have also reported a decrease in depression, anxiety and trauma response being alleviated from breathwork sessions.
